## Releases — Undo/Redo Stack

Draftloom's diagram editor now persists the undo/redo stack per canvas, surviving reloads. For the weekly sync: release 4.2 changes the history serialization format, so builds must migrate stored stacks on first open. Test undo across grouped shapes and connector edits before tagging. Release candidates are uploaded to the Kellner artifact store and rejected unless signed. The current signing key for 4.2 builds appears below.

signing key of fahag-tadug = bky9_XH2KCQnPM

Supplier Renewal — Marrowgate Logistics (Managers Only)

Contract expires end of Q1. Terms broadly acceptable; volume discounts improved. Open items: liability cap, fuel surcharge formula. Ops prefers renewal; procurement wants a parallel quote from Selvane Freight as leverage. Decision needed within three weeks to avoid rollover clause. Incoming director should review the negotiation file before the next steering call. The confidential strategy position is appended below.

confidential, bahip-hadug: Headcount on the Norir team goes from 29 to 116 by the end of August. Gross margin on Norir came in at 6 percent against a plan of 59 percent.

## Authentication

SheetForge plugins exporting large spreadsheets should stream rows rather than buffering whole workbooks; memory usage grows linearly with in-flight sheets, so keep concurrent exports below four. All export endpoints require authenticated requests, and unauthenticated calls are rejected before any allocation occurs. Plugin authors must attach credentials to every streaming request. Use the bearer token shown below for sandbox testing.

session JWT of yawep-yawep = eyJhbGciOiJIUzI1NiIsInR5cCI6IkpXVCJ9.eyJzdWIiOiI3pWF3_In0.aXYsHiog

Hey Marisol — quick handover before I'm out. The chatterbox here is Pinglet's event-router: it logs every heartbeat, so we sample aggressively or the disk fills by noon. Don't bump the sample rate past 10% without checking ingest costs with Dev first. If pages fire overnight, check the sampler first. Current settings are as follows.

config for kafof-bawef:
holath:
  log_level: debug
  metrics_host: metrics.holath.qorvelsys.internal
  pin: 2191
  pool_size: 32